Supplies wanted

  • butter – Base for frosting. For the smoothest, fluffiest texture, make sure that the butter is softened to room temperature.
  • vanilla essence – Provides heat and enhances the chocolate taste.
  • cocoa powder – Star of the present! Utilizing unsweetened cocoa powder will give it a wealthy chocolate-like style.
  • powdered sugar – Weakens the frosting and provides it a traditional buttercream texture.
  • milk – You should use almond milk or common milk to skinny the frosting to your required consistency.

Alternative and notes

  • go vegan: It is simple to make this chocolate buttercream vegan or dairy-free. Use a vegan butter like Earth Steadiness or MIYOKO’S CREAMERY, and exchange milk with plant-based choices like almond milk, oat milk, or coconut milk.
  • low carb choices: For a lower-carb model, attempt utilizing powdered erythritol or Swerve Confectioners Sugar as an alternative of powdered sugar. Sugar substitutes differ in sweetness, so begin with much less and alter to style.
  • add a twist: Swap vanilla extract for almond, coconut, or peppermint extract for enjoyable and distinctive taste variations.

How you can make chocolate buttercream frosting

Step 1: Add butter and vanilla to a big mixing bowl. Utilizing a hand mixer or stand mixer, beat till gentle and fluffy.

Step 2: Add the cocoa powder and powdered sugar, 1 cup at a time, and beat on medium pace till fully mixed and easy.

Step 3: Add milk 1 tablespoon at a time till desired consistency is achieved.

Step 4: Take pleasure in frosting in your favourite cupcakes or truffles.

Brittany’s Tip!

  • soften the butter: Be certain the butter is at room temperature earlier than you begin. Softened butter mixes extra simply and helps create a easy, fluffy frosting.
  • Sift the powdered sugar: For the creamiest texture, sift the powdered sugar earlier than including to the combination. This can assist take away the lump.
  • Add milk little by little: Begin with 1 tablespoon of milk at a time and add till desired consistency. You may add them at any time, however you can’t delete them.
  • Don’t over combine: You need the frosting to be fluffy, however over-mixing could cause it to lose construction. Combine till all the things is easy and creamy.

Storing leftover frosting

fridge – Leftover chocolate buttercream could be saved in an hermetic container within the fridge for as much as 1 week. When utilizing it, let it sit at room temperature for about half-hour to melt, then whisk shortly to revive its fluffy, creamy texture.

freezer – Need to put it aside for later? This frosting freezes fantastically! Retailer in a freezer protected container for as much as 3 months. When prepared to make use of, thaw within the fridge in a single day and whisk once more for a dreamy consistency.

FAQ

Why is the frosting grainy?

If the powdered sugar is just not fully included, a grainy frosting will happen. Make sure you add the powdered sugar 1 cup at a time, mixing effectively after every addition. Sifting the sugar beforehand helps obtain a superbly easy texture.

What is the secret to fluffy chocolate frosting?

It is all about flogging! Beat the butter till gentle and fluffy earlier than including the opposite substances, then combine all the things on medium pace for the right fluffy end result. There isn’t any have to rush this step. It is price the additional couple of minutes.

Can I exploit salted butter?

I used evenly salted butter from Straus Creamery. I actually like this as a result of it provides a refined taste of salt with out being too overpowering. That stated, I normally use unsalted butter for buttercream frosting, so I’ve higher management over the flavour. Nonetheless, for those who solely have salted butter, you may undoubtedly use that.
